Civil Engineering Design and Permitting Process

The structural engineering design and permitting process involves a meticulous series of stages to ensure the safety, stability, and regulatory compliance of a structure. It begins with carrying out a thorough analysis of the project requirements, including site conditions, load parameters, and building codes. Based on this evaluation, structural engineers develop detailed design drawings and specifications that outline the structural systems and their interrelationships.

These designs are then filed to the relevant permitting authorities for review and approval. The permitting agency scrutinizes the submitted documents to confirm that they comply with all applicable building codes, safety standards, and environmental regulations. Throughout this cycle, engineers may be required to resolve any comments or concerns raised by the permitting authority.

  • Finally, upon successful completion of the permitting process, a building permit is authorized, allowing construction to proceed.

Grasping PE Stamp Requirements for Construction Plans

When submitting construction plans for approval, it's crucial to ensure they comply with all building requirements. One such specification is the inclusion of a Professional Engineer (PE) stamp. This stamp certifies that the plans have been examined by a licensed PE who agrees they meet the necessary safety and design standards. Absence to include this stamp can result in delays, obstacles, and even legal issues.

To properly understand the PE stamp requirements, it's necessary to consult with your local regulatory codes. These codes will outline the specific guidelines for obtaining a pe stamp PE stamp and the data that must be included on the stamp itself. Moreover, it's always a good idea to advise with an experienced PE who can provide you specific guidance based on your project.

Construction Regulations , Stability, and Applications for Approval

When embarking on any construction project, it is paramount to adhere to building codes established by local jurisdictions. These codes serve as a guideline for ensuring the security of occupants and compliance with minimum structural specifications. Before commencing construction, it is imperative to submit comprehensive permit applications to the relevant authorities. These applications provide proof of how the proposed structure will satisfy all pertinent building codes and demonstrate the intended structural integrity.

Permit reviewers will carefully examine these applications to confirm that the design drawings adequately address stability issues and align with established safety protocols. Failure to obtain the necessary permits before starting construction can lead to severe penalties, including citations. Moreover, constructing without proper authorization can jeopardize the structural stability of a building, posing potential risks to occupants and property.
